    There are a variety of cuisine options here – sushi, stir fry, Thai. It’s all pretty good. The dining area is modern. Very standard fare – no surprises. There are better places but this one is not bad.

    I love the hibachi at wild ginger! The experience is always great, and the chefs seem very skilled at their tricks. Steak is always cooked perfectly. The hee ma roll is also one of my favorite sushi rolls!

    First time. Went here for dinner on NYE. Great place for a date, but saw several families here also. Modern, moody lighting, busy vibe. Cocktails, sushi, fried green beans with beef, amd sake were all excellent and delicious Prompt friendly service without being overbearing. Not inexpensive, but very high quality. Would most definitely go again; I’m a new fan!

    Was going to wild ginger for 6 years and always had good food. The dragon roll is soooo good -Spicy and sweet-. The shrimp tampora is great with the duck sauce. It is kind of expensive, but it’s totally worth it.

    I have not had the sushi, but my friends have tried it and liked it. I usually go for the Thai cuisines and the soups (when cold). I particularly like the pho.I have tried their hibachi and am one for one. The first time, it was very good, but when I went again a few weeks later, the chef used too much soy sauce (it was the same guy) and it was salty.The other food is good so I have been reluctant to try the hibachi, which is unfortunate as the quality of the ingredients was evident the first time but masked the second.Regardless, I come often as my friends and I meet here for lunch.The decor is nice but parking can pose a problem.

    A favorite for lunch. Wild Ginger is a place I really like for lunch. The Sushi is great and a lunch combo is the way to go without breaking the bank. If you are with someone who does not fancy Sushi – no problem. There are plenty of other menu items to choose from.Dinner can get crowded & pricey. That is why I prefer Wild Ginger as a lunch spot.

    Charming!. Wild Ginger popped up under a Google search for ‘romantic dining’ – and this locale is definitely a delightful place for anything from a sophisticated date to a rowdy Hibachi grill party. We enjoyed all of our menu items from the seaweed salad, to the red, yellow, and green curries, to the Summer Rolls. How did they create such a zingy mint flavor in a roll? ‘Want that recipe! Portion sizes were quite generous – even the guys couldn’t finish theirs, and when was the last time I was served enough scallops to take some home? Our plum wine drinkers loved the flavor but were surprised to find that they could barely polish off their large glasses of the deceptively potent potion. We were from out-of-state and road-weary when we found the crew at Wild Ginger, and we would have loved to have taken them all back home with us.
